Brian Foddy wrote: > My NFS mounting params: > rsize=8192,wsize=8192,hard,intr,nfsvers=3,actimeo=0,tcp I'd go for bigger rsize / wsize. If you use udp the stack will not throttle because it tries to be nice to other network activities like tcp does. Tcp makes sense on networks with potential loss, e.g. WANs, but not on a home LAN.
